Global financial leaders to convene in Saudi Arabia for FSC

The global financial community will gather from March 15 to 16 in the Saudi capital Riyadh for the second edition of the Financial Sector Conference (FSC 2023) and shape the agenda for the international financial community.

Leaders and senior executives from some of the most prominent international institutions will work alongside government ministers and top-level decision makers to help set the industry agenda for 2023 and explore innovative solutions to unprecedented challenges facing the sector. FSC 2023 is taking a confident outlook on the sector with the event being held under the conference slogan – “Promising Financial Horizons”.

The 2023 conference has already attracted representatives from leading banks, venture capitalists, market specialists and investment gurus from Asia, Europe and North America to join regional experts in a series of insightful presentations and timely panel discussions and debates. Companies represented include Goldman Sachs; Credit Suisse; HSBC; Deutsche Bank; JP Morgan and S & P Ratings among many others.
